Finite-β stabilization of the universal drift instability: revisited

The stabilization of the universal drift instability due to finite β effects (i.e., electromagnetic coupling and delB orbit modifications) is studied numerically and a marginal stability curve (as a function of β and k) is presented. It is found that the most difficult modes to stabilize have arbitrarily small wavenumbers and the critical value of β is β/sub cr/ approx. =0.135 for T/sub e/ = T/sub i/
